Crawfordsville had lost four straight on the road, but  on Friday they dropped down to 3-5 to make it five. They came up short against  the Greencastle Tiger Cubs, falling  38-14. If the Athenians were looking for revenge after losing  27-6 to the Tiger Cubs when the teams met back in August of 2021, then they'll just have to keep looking.
 Although Crawfordsville took the loss, they still got scores from  Landon Gerold and  Daniel Surface.
As for Greencastle,  the  win  got them back to even at 4-4. The high-flying offensive performance was a huge turnaround for they considering their 13-point performance the  contest before.
  Cole Stephens had another great game (as  he tends to do), throwing for 390 yards and three  TDs while completing 79.3% of his passes, and also rushing for 40 yards and one  score. Greencastle is 4-1 when  Stephens posts three or  more  passing touchdowns, but 0-3 otherwise. The Tiger Cubs' leading receiver  Trevin Long was  Stephens' top target yet again, picking up 146 receiving yards and one  touchdown.
 Looking ahead, Crawfordsville will be playing in front of their home fans against Frankfort  at 7:00  p.m.  on Friday. The Athenians will be up against the Hot Dogs' rather soft defense (which has allowed 53.13  points per  game),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ance. As for Greencastle, they will challenge Southmont at 7:00  p.m.  on Friday.
